Organizational Buying Process

The Organizational Buying Process is the series of steps and decision-making criteria that businesses and institutions use to evaluate and purchase products or services for operational needs.

Prospect Theory

A behavioral economic theory that describes how people decide between probabilistic alternatives that involve risk.

Problem Recognition

The initial step in the consumer decision process, where a consumer identifies a need or problem that requires a solution or purchase.

Evoked Set

A group of relevant brands or products that a consumer considers when making a purchasing decision.
